• The squirrel trail

    26 July 2024
    The Kalisz Squirrel Trail is a walking route that combines recreational and educational values. This project, designed for both residents an...
    d tourists, encourages active exploration of the city. Hidden throughout Kalisz are small bronze squirrel figurines that invite visitors on an urban adventure. Initiated in 2024 by Krystian Kinastowski, the Mayor of Kalisz, the trail now includes eight stops across notable locations in the city.

  • Guests from Hamm explore the Prosna river

    19 March 2024
    As part of an international project, Robert Biermann and Tim Wegner, filmmakers and environmental enthusiasts from the German partner city o...
    f Hamm, along with Ewa Ćwiertnia, coordinator from the Internationaler Club Hamms, visited Kalisz to be able to gather material for a series of documentary films showing the biodiversity of the river systems of their hometown and its sister cities.

  • Stefan Szolc-Rogozinski returned to Poland

    05 October 2023
    More than 120 years after his death, the earthly remains of Stefan Szolc-Rogoziński were brought to Poland. Mayor Krystian Kinastowski, alon...
    g with a group of residents of Kalisz, participated in the ceremony held in Paris.
